Output 17fcdc177224d875590e4797d18859737b10c8814f49fb61b25f3179ebaff1a0:7

value
70000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52af941e2733a37ba8c683059010cd1eaa58d018 OP_EQUAL
address
39EDfgr3rRpub4tb39fPnXxywA1E85gvfX
transaction
17fcdc177224d875590e4797d18859737b10c8814f49fb61b25f3179ebaff1a0
spent
true